[{"type":"text","content":"\n\nCadence Minerals Plc\n \n(\"Cadence Minerals\", \"Cadence\", or \"the Company\")\n \nCorporate Update - Evergreen Lithium (ASX: EG1) Commences Drilling & Continues Field Activities at Bynoe\n \nCadence Minerals (AIM: KDNC; OTC: KDNCY) is pleased to note that ASX listed Evergreen Lithium Limited (\"Evergreen\") (ASX: EG1) has announced the commencement of RAB/Aircore drilling at its highly prospective Bynoe Project directly east of Core Lithium's Finniss Mine. The RAB/Aircore drilling will be used to test priority targets and to further progress geochemical studies in higher priority areas obscured by Quaternary and Tertiary cover units.\n \nGearing up for this second field program follows the approval of the Company's Mine Management Plan (MMP) in April 2024, and ground conditions being dry enough to allow access for heavier vehicles.\n \nGeochemical, geophysical and mapping activities completed to date demonstrate the potential for lithium bearing LCT pegmatite style mineralisation within EverGreen's EL 31774 lease.\n \nHighlights:\n·      RAB/Aircore drilling has commenced successfully at the Bynoe Project\n·      Early auger program results provide further direction towards identifying potential lithium-cesium-tantalum (LCT) pegmatite corridors at Bynoe\n·      Planned work programs for 2024 will include auger and RAB/AC drilling, field mapping with potential follow-up RC and diamond drilling\n \nLink here to view the full Evergreen ASX announcement\n \nEvergreen Exploration Manager Andrew Harwood commented: \"We are pleased to have commenced drilling on EverGreen Lithium's 231km2 lease at the Bynoe Project, one of the largest land holdings in the Bynoe Pegmatite Field. The Company believes that this project hosts excellent and compelling drill-ready lithium targets.\"\n \n\"The RAB/AC drilling program's primary objectives are lithological mapping beneath the thin cover units, and to test priority targets.
